r语言xlsx包(r语言xlsx包加载不了)
简介
xlsx 包是一个 R 语言包,用于读写 Microsoft Excel (.xlsx) 文件。它提供了一组函数,使您可以轻松地操作电子表格中的数据,包括读取、写入、修改和格式化工作表、单元格和图表。
多级标题
### 读取 Excel 文件要读取 Excel 文件,可以使用 `read_excel()` 函数。该函数接受一个文件路径作为参数,并返回一个数据框,其中包含电子表格中的数据。```r library(xlsx) data <- read_excel("my_data.xlsx") ```### 写入 Excel 文件要写入 Excel 文件,可以使用 `write_excel()` 函数。该函数接受一个数据框和一个文件路径作为参数,并将数据写入电子表格。```r write_excel(data, "my_data_output.xlsx") ```### 修改工作表要修改工作表,可以使用 `edit_excel()` 函数。该函数接受一个文件路径和一个修改函数作为参数。修改函数负责对电子表格进行所需的更改。```r edit_excel("my_data.xlsx", function(sheet) {sheet[1, 1] <- "New Value"sheet$A2 <- "New Row" }) ```### 格式化工作表要格式化工作表,可以使用 `format_excel()` 函数。该函数接受一个文件路径和一个格式化函数作为参数。格式化函数负责对电子表格进行所需的格式化更改。```r format_excel("my_data.xlsx", function(sheet) {sheet$A1:B10 %>%format_fill(color = "yellow") %>%format_font(bold = TRUE) }) ```### 创建图表要创建图表,可以使用 `add_chart()` 函数。该函数接受一个文件路径、一个图表类型和一些其他参数作为参数。```r add_chart("my_data.xlsx", "line", data = data, x_axis = "Date", y_axis = "Value") ```### 其他功能xlsx 包还提供以下其他功能:
合并和拆分工作表
插入和删除行和列
应用条件格式
设置工作表属性
使用公式